ZIP 62321 vs ZIP 62330
A side-by-side comparison of ZIP Code 62321 and ZIP Code 62330: population, income, housing, and more.
ZIP 62321 and ZIP 62330 are ZIP Code areas in Illinois.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.
ZIP 62321 has the higher population (3,682 vs 1,548 in ZIP 62330). ZIP 62321 has the higher median household income ($74,859 vs $57,083 in ZIP 62330). ZIP 62321 has the higher median home value ($120,600 vs $83,600 in ZIP 62330).
Population, income & housing
| ZIP 62321 | ZIP 62330 | |
|---|---|---|
| Population | 3,682 | 1,548 |
| Median age | 50.0 yrs | 50.8 yrs |
| Median household income | $74,859 | $57,083 |
| Median home value | $120,600 | $83,600 |
| Median gross rent | $677 | $831 |
| Housing units | 1,892 | 870 |
| Homeownership rate | 76.5% | 85.3% |
| Bachelor's degree or higher | 33.3% | 17.1% |
| Unemployment rate | 1.6% | 3.8% |
